When Rommel’s forces landed in North Africa, their main tank destroyer was the Panzerjäger I Ausf B. This was augmented later in the campaign by the various types of Marders. Does anyone have a break down on which Marders actually arrived, as there were quite a few types with I, II & III plus Ausf H & M.

I guess that some of these may have arrived during the Tunisian phase of this campaign, so as anyone got a list showing which types arrived first and which followed, plus totals please would be great.

The Marder sent to Rommel before Tunisia were SdKfz 139 Marder III with the Soviet 76.2mm gun. No other Marders were sent until the reinforcements arrived in Tunisia. To find out which types arrived in Tunisia you'd have to look through the issue lists for the Divisions which were in Tunisia. I know there were some SdKfz 131 Marder II.
